Compositions and methods for lowering triglycerides
In various embodiments, the present invention provides compositions and methods for treating and/or preventing cardiovascular-related diseases in subject in need thereof.

A method of lowering triglycerides in a subject on stable statin therapy having fasting triglycerides of about 200 mg/dl to about 500 mg/dl, the method comprising administering to the subject a composition comprising about 1 g to about 4 g of eicosapentaenoic acid and docosahexaenoic acid in free acid form per day for a period effective to reduce fasting triglycerides in the subject wherein the composition comprises at least 96% by weight eicosapentaenoic acid.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the subject has serum LDL-C levels of about 40 mg/dl to about 115 mg/dl.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the composition is administered to the subject 1 to 4 times per day.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ein the composition is present in one or more capsules.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ein 2 g of the composition is administered to the subject per day and each of said one or more capsules contains about 800 mg to about 1200 mg of eicosapentaenoic acid.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ein each of said one or more capsules contains not more than about 4%, by weight, of any individual fatty acid selected from docosahexanoic acid, linolenic acid, alpha-linolenic acid, stearidonic acid, eicosatrienoic acid and docosapentaenoic acid.
7. The method of claim 1 wherein the period effective to reduce fasting triglycerides is about 1 week to about 15 weeks.
8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the period effective to reduce fasting triglycerides is about 1 week to about 12 weeks.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the period effective to reduce fasting triglycerides is about 1 week to about 5 weeks.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the subject exhibits an increase in serum EPA and DHA at the end of said period effective to reduce fasting triglycerides.
